Tired of rummaging through project bags and opening them all, just to find a specific WIP? MidMitten Designs’ “Whatcha’ Making?” project bags, with “windows” on the front, make it super easy to see what’s inside.

Made in several sizes by a persnickety home economist, these bags are as good looking on the inside as they are on the outside. Zippers have everything that could catch removed and covered with fabric. All interior seams are bound with bias tape or serged to prevent raveling and keep your projects safe. The XL project bag, with seven (!) interior slip pockets, is perfectly sized for sweaters and afghans and has a vinyl pocket on the front of the bag that’s perfect for keeping the pattern visible while you knit (and the zipper on the pocket keeps all the notions from escaping).

Hogsmead Treat Bag Preorder

A Halloween Fiber Treat Inspired by the Candy and Sweets of the Harry Potter Series

Harry Potter and fellow Hogwarts students looked forward to the Hogsmead Weekends. Hogsmead Weekends were designated weekends throughout the year when 3rd year and above students with signed consent forms could visit and shop in the nearby village of Hogsmead. A favorite shop was Honeydukes, the candy and sweets shop. Treat bags are limited edition fiber assortments containing a combination of batts, smidgens, and custom blend roving inspired by the candy and sweets in the Harry Potter series.

These treat bags will be similar to the Hogsmead Weekends Fiber Club I have had in the past. However, this is a one time release and while I may revisit inspiration candies used before, the fibers will be all new for this release and not remakes of past colorways.

These are available as a preorder only. Treat Bags will ship the first to mid part of October.

Each Treat Bag will contain an assortment of 6 oz of fiber, plus some extras from the studio. One extra that is already in the works is a special batch of handmade soap. The soap is small batch, cold process, and unscented, but created especially for this Treat Bag.

This fiber assortment will contain wool from my farm with luxury add-ins. The wool from my farm may include Purebred Romeldale/CVM wool, Registered American Gotland wool and/or crossbred wool.

These Treat Bags have Angelina (sparkle). If you would like to order one without sparkle, please message me with that request at the time of your purchase.
